Renault Wind

  • Renault Wind Coupe-Roadster

    French automaker Renault will be using next month’s 2010 Geneva Motor Show to unveil a brand new hard-top convertible based on its Twingo hatchback. Dubbed the Renault Wind, the new cruiser is described as a “coupe-roadster” and is definitely off-limits for the U.S. market. The Renault Wind measures 12.5 feet in length and features an innovative way of opening up--an electric roof that pivots open in just 12 seconds and affords the Wind its sleek profile.
